Interior design is all about crafting spaces that are both functional and visually appealing. It’s a creative process that combines art, science, and practicality to enhance the way people experience an environment. Here’s how it typically works:
- Understanding the Client’s Needs: The designer begins by discussing with the client to understand their goals, preferences, budget, and lifestyle requirements.
- Concept Development: This phase involves creating a vision for the space. It could include mood boards, sketches, or digital renderings to communicate ideas effectively.
- Space Planning: Designers analyze the layout to ensure the space is used efficiently, taking into account furniture placement, lighting, and overall flow.
- Color and Material Selection: Choosing a palette, textures, and materials that align with the concept and suit the functionality of the space is crucial.
- Furniture and Decor: Designers select pieces that complement the overall theme, keeping comfort, style, and usability in mind.
- Lighting Design: Lighting plays a pivotal role in setting the mood and highlighting key features of the space.
- Implementation: The final stage involves coordinating with contractors, suppliers, and installers to bring the vision to life.
Interior design is more than just decoration; it’s about creating spaces that resonate with the people using them. Whether it’s a cozy living room or a sleek office, the designer ensures every element serves a purpose while adding aesthetic value.
